There are 110 livery companies, comprising London's ancient and modern trade associations and guilds, almost all of which are styled the 'Worshipful Company of' their respective craft, trade or profession. The Guild was formed in 1992 with the aim of uniting all Livery Company Beadles for social events, to preserve the traditions of the City … party stores in chico caSpletThe oldest London guild was The Weavers’ Company, which received its Royal Charter in 1155. Over time, groups of craftsmen involved in the different stages of clothmaking formed and later became independent of The Weavers’ Company.
